Manual:Running MediaWiki on free.fr/fr

From MediaWiki.org
Jump to navigation Jump to search
Guides d'installation
FreeBSD
GNU/Linux
- ALT Linux
- Arch Linux
- Damnsmalllinux
- Debian or Ubuntu
- Fedora
- Gentoo
- Mandriva
- Red Hat Enterprise Linux or CentOS
- Slackware
Mac OS X
NetWare
Solaris
- Solaris 11 / opensolaris
- Solaris 10
Windows
- Windows Server 2016
- Windows Subsystem for Linux
sur clé USB
- Uniform Server
- XAMPP
Sourceforge.net

ATTENTION, cette page d'installation est obsolète !
Elle décrit une installation inutilement compliquée et prêtant à confusion.
Il est vivement recommandé de consulter en lieu et place, la page Installation Médiawiki chez free.fr.

Installation sur serveur non dédié[edit]

Préparation pour l'installation sur free.fr[edit]

  • Ensuite, les étapes à suivre sont les suivantes :
    • Transférez par ftp tout le contenu de EasyPHP/www/ sauf LocalSettings.php
    • Transférez les tables créées dans votre base de données. Il faut pour cela :
      • Accédez à votre base de données locale, en cliquant dans EasyPhp sur "administration" puis "BDD", ce qui vous amène à une page "PhpMyadmin"
      • Cliquez sur NomdelaBDD dans le volet de gauche : les tables créées par MediaWiki s'affichent dans le volet de droite. Cliquez sur "Exporter" en haut du volet de droite, puis sur "Tout sélectioner", ce qui sélectionne toutes les tables. Sélectionnez pour votre exportation "format zippé". Cliquez enfin sur "exécuter". Un fichier Zip s'enregistre alors sur votre ordinateur. Dézipez-le, vous obtenez un fichier texte nommé comme cela : NomdelaBDD.sql
      • Il faut maintenant transférer cela sur votre base de données free. Vous y accédez par http://sql.free.fr. Vous vous identifiez, puis vous cliquez à gauche sur "Votrelogin", puis sur l'icône marquée "SQL". Vous cliquez alors sur "parcourir" en-dessous de "emplacement du ficher texte", puis "exécuter". Vos tables sont maintenant transférées.

Modifications pour l'installation[edit]

  • Il faut enfin modifier le fichier "LocalSettings.php". Ouvrez-le avec le bloc-notes. Puis :

Avant la ligne :

if( defined( 'MW_INSTALL_PATH' ) ) { ... 

ajoutez la ligne suivante :

define( 'MW_INSTALL_PATH', $_SERVER['DOCUMENT_ROOT'].'/ mon répertoire d'installation' );

(sans oublier de remplacer '/ mon répertoire d'installation :) ( [source] )

  • trouver la ligne contenant :
$wgScriptPath = "<un/chemin/vers/l'installation>",

puis effacez ce chemin pour obtenir:

$wgScriptPath = ""


  • le bloc suivant doit être rempli comme suit :
$wgDBserver         = "sql.free.fr";
$wgDBname           = "<nom de la base>";
$wgDBuser           = "<nom de l'utilisateur chez Free>";
$wgDBpassword       = "<mot de passe>";

Chez Free, le nom de la base est le même que celui de l'utilisateur et que l'adresse du site (sauf si le nom utilisateur contient un point (ex: "prenom.nom"). Dans ce cas, la base s'appelle "prenom_nom").

  • Vous pouvez maintenant envoyer ce fichier à la racine de votre site web.
  • Enfin, créez un dossier "sessions" à la racine de votre site web.
  • Tapez dans votre navigateur l'adresse de votre site : votre wiki apparaît !

Autres modifications non testées :[edit]

puis remplacez :

$wgArticlePath = "$wgScript/$1";

par :

#$wgArticlePath = "$wgScript/$1";

(Il suffit d'ajouter le #)

et enfin, de même, remplacez :

#$wgArticlePath = "$wgScript?title=$1";

par :

$wgArticlePath = "$wgScript?title=$1";

(Il suffit d'enlever le #)


Enfin, ajoutez n'importe où dans le fichier la ligne suivante :

$wgUseDatabaseMessages = false;